S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ash certification Career Path and Benefits
Professionals typically enter as SAP billing consultants and grow toward senior revenue management architects over time. The S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ash certification marks a clear step in that progression. In the United States, certified professionals in this space earn between $95,000 and $130,000 annually. German professionals holding this credential see base salaries reaching €75,000 to €100,000 in enterprise roles. Titles like SAP BRIM functional consultant and revenue operations lead are common landing points. Senior positions often include solution design ownership across billing cycles. The certification doesn't replace project experience. Still, it signals a level of product knowledge that hiring teams actively look for.
Is S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ash Certification Worth It?
Subscription-based business models grew by over 435% across service industries in the past decade, per Zuora's Subscription Economy Index. That growth has pushed demand for S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ash skills into enterprise procurement cycles. Companies running complex usage-based pricing need specialists who understand the full cash conversion flow. That specificity is what gives this certification real market weight. It's not a general finance credential. One factual risk worth noting is that SAP BRIM implementations remain concentrated in large enterprises. Professionals in smaller markets may find fewer active projects to apply these skills against.
S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ash certification Global Trends
Saudi Arabia has seen rising demand for SAP Billing and Revenue Innovation Management - Usage to Cash expertise as telecom and utility sectors shift to consumption-based billing. The United States holds the highest volume of active BRIM implementations globally. Germany is home to several SAP-native enterprises running large-scale revenue management programs. Australia's energy and telecommunications sectors have driven steady certification demand across the past four years. The United Kingdom also maintains consistent hiring activity, particularly within managed services and subscription commerce firms. Markets tied to utility deregulation and telecom expansion are likely to drive the next wave of demand for this certification through the late 2020s.
